    Erysimum, commonly known as wallflowers, bring vibrant colour and wildlife benefits to UK gardens. These hardy perennials thrive in sunny spots with well-drained soil. Their nectar-rich flowers attract bees, butterflies, and other pollinators from early spring.

    Wallflowers support biodiversity by providing food for insects when few other plants are in bloom. Some species, like Erysimum cheiri, have a sweet fragrance that draws pollinators. Their compact growth suits borders, rockeries, and containers. Once established, they tolerate drought and poor soil, making them low-maintenance. Many varieties self-seed, creating natural drifts of colour year after year.
